How to Choose the Best Infant Nutritionist in Town.

One of the most important things you can do when choosing an infant nutritionist is to find a doctor who is experienced and knowledgeable in the matter. Ask your doctor for referrals and take the time to ask questions about what they specialize in. You also want to make sure to get a sample of their services, so that you can see if they are a good fit for your needs.
